KENTUCKY HOT BROWNS

Number Of Ingredients 10

4 oz butter
1/2 c flour
2 c chicken broth
2 c scalded milk
salt and pepper to taste
1/2 c grated romano cheese
4 slice toast
8 slice bacon
12 slice turkey breast
8 slice tomatoes

Steps:

  • 1. In a saucepan melt butter and blend in flour, but do not let brown.
  • 2. Remove sauce pan from heat and chill.
  • 3. Heat broth and milk to boiling point.
  • 4. Add hot milk to the flour mixture while beating vigorously with a wire whisk until sauce thickens.
  • 5. Season with salt, pepper and cheese. Simmer until cheese melts.
  • 6. To assemble hot browns, trim toast and place on 4 individual ovenproof platters.
  • 7. Arrange the turkey slices over the toast and cover completely with cream sauce.
  • 8. Place 2 slices of tomatoes and two strips of bacon on each dish.
  • 9. Place platters in preheated 375 degree oven until hot browns are bubbly.
  • 10. This will serve four.
